Incumbent Japanese Prime Minister Shinzo Abe is highly likely to win tomorrow’s party leadership contest, thus enabling him to retain the premiership for a third and final term.
In this podcast, we discuss what such an outcome will mean for Japan’s economic, foreign and defence policy, and how this will impact Japan’s socio-economic health as well as the broader regional environment.
